Dude, Where's My Digital Upfront?

For some, talk of A digital upfront means a surging medium on the brink of maturity. For others, it feels more like a cutting-edge business being forced to use the fax machine when a perfectly good e-mail client sits on the desktop.

It’s that time of year again, when attention turns to this Sasquatch of the media world. (Some swear they’ve seen this mysterious creature in person, while others call it a delusion-fueled myth.) Despite some high-profile past missteps among Web players putting on upfront events, the mixed opinions of media buyers and rising sentiment that even the annual broadcast negotiations that are their model are dying a slow death, several big players–including Microsoft and Broadband Enterprises–have already hosted or are planning to host their own upfront-styled events this year, complete with free booze and cheeses of the world.
